📘 About This Book

Deep underground, the City of Ember has provided humanity with its only known home for generations. Built as a last refuge, the massive subterranean settlement relies entirely on a sprawling system of electric lights to keep the encroaching darkness and unknown dangers at bay. However, after two hundred years of continuous operation, the city is beginning to fail. Blackouts are becoming more frequent, essential supplies are dwindling, and the vast generator that powers the city is showing signs of irreversible decay. As fear and uncertainty spread among the citizens, two young residents stumble upon an ancient document that contains fragmented instructions left behind by the mysterious founders of the city. Recognizing the desperate situation, they embark on a perilous journey to decipher the faded message and uncover the truth about their world. Against a backdrop of decaying infrastructure, social unrest, and institutional secrecy, the story explores themes of resource depletion, hope, curiosity, and the human drive for survival and discovery. As the glowing lights of their fragile home flicker toward permanent darkness, the quest to find a way out becomes a race against time for everyone living beneath the earth.

📖 Summary

City of Ember by Jeanne DuPrau presents a fascinating exploration of a subterranean society facing imminent collapse. Deep underground, the titular City of Ember has served as the sole known refuge for humanity for generations. Constructed as a last hope to preserve the human race, this massive underground settlement depends entirely on a sprawling, complex system of electric lights to push back the encroaching darkness and the unknown dangers lurking beyond the boundaries of the city. For two hundred years, this artificial ecosystem sustained its inhabitants, but time is catching up with the ambitious engineering project. The novel centers around a crisis of sustainability and societal decay as the city begins to fail in alarming ways. Blackouts are no longer isolated incidents; instead, they are becoming longer and more frequent, plunging sections of the population into terrifying darkness. At the same time, essential supplies are dwindling rapidly in the storehouses, and the colossal generator that powers the entire existence of the city is showing undeniable signs of irreversible decay. Fear, panic, and uncertainty begin to spread among the ordinary citizens as the infrastructure crumbles around them. Amid this mounting dread, the narrative follows two young residents who stumble upon an ancient document. This mysterious artifact contains fragmented instructions left behind by the original founders of the city, offering a faint glimmer of hope in a darkening world. Recognizing the desperate nature of their situation and the apathy of the adults around them, the two protagonists embark on a perilous journey to decipher the cryptic message. They must navigate a maze of fading lights, crumbling corridors, and rising social tension as they attempt to uncover the truth about their home and find a way to save humanity before the lights go out forever. The book examines themes of resource depletion, institutional decay, human resilience, and the courage required to question established systems when survival is on the line.
